Cheney Reservoir is a 9,537-acre reservoir on the North Fork Ninnescah River in Reno and Kingman counties in south-central Kansas — the primary recreational boating destination for the Wichita metropolitan area and the most accessible large reservoir to Kansas’s largest city. The lake sits approximately 20 miles west of downtown Wichita, making it a genuine day-trip and after-work boating destination for the Wichita metro population throughout the open water season. Cheney State Park on the lake’s eastern shore is one of the most popular sailing destinations in Kansas — consistent south winds across the open prairie reservoir create reliable sailing conditions that draw the Wichita sailing community to Cheney throughout the spring, summer, and fall seasons. Walleye, largemouth bass, crappie, white bass, and channel catfish provide the primary fishery managed by the Kansas Department of Wildlife and Parks. Kansas Boating FAQ


Kansas uses a 3-year registration cycle. As of 2026, the flat fee is $42.50 regardless of the vessel’s length.


Huge news for Kansas boaters: Starting January 1, 2026, all watercraft, boat motors, and boat trailers are exempt from personal property tax. You no longer need to list them with the county appraiser.


No. Kansas does not title watercraft. Your Bill of Sale and previous registration are your primary proof of ownership. Keep them safe, especially if you plan to sell to an out-of-state buyer.


Anyone born on or after January 1, 1989, must complete an approved boater safety course to operate any motorized vessel or sailboat on public waters.


To stop the spread of Zebra mussels, you must remove all drain plugs from bilges and livewells before transporting your boat on any public highway. “Clean, Drain, Dry” is the law of the land.
